How to Invest in Cryptocurrencies Using ETFs and ETNs

Cryptocurrencies operate independently of traditional government-backed currencies like the Euro or the US Dollar. Among the most popular digital assets are Bitcoin, Ether, Bitcoin Cash, and Ripple. Ownership of these cryptocurrencies is verified through cryptographic keys, while transactions are securely processed across decentralized computer networks—eliminating the need for intermediaries like banks. This system relies on blockchain technology, a synchronized and transparent ledger.

How Do Crypto ETFs and ETNs Work?

The value of cryptocurrencies fluctuates based on market demand, much like stocks. New coins are generated through a process called “mining,” which involves solving complex cryptographic puzzles requiring significant computational power and energy. Some c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in, have a capped supply to maintain scarcity.

While many investors treat cryptocurrencies as digital assets rather than payment methods, gaining exposure to their returns has become easier through Exchange-Traded Notes (ETNs). These financial instruments often hold physical crypto coins as collateral, providing a secure way to invest.

In Europe, UCITS regulations restrict the creation of single-asset crypto ETFs, making ETNs the primary vehicle for crypto investments. Some ETNs track multiple cryptocurrencies, allowing diversified exposure through a single product.

Staking Rewards and Blockchain ETFs

Certain crypto ETNs offer staking rewards, benefiting investors who hold proof-of-stake cryptocurrencies like Ether. Staking involves locking up coins to validate blockchain transactions, earning rewards in return. Some ETNs pass these rewards to investors via reduced fees or increased coin allocations.

For those interested in broader blockchain exposure, Blockchain ETFs invest in companies developing blockchain infrastructure and technology. These ETFs provide indirect access to the crypto market without directly holding digital assets.

Comparing Crypto ETFs and ETNs

When selecting a crypto ETF or ETN, consider these key factors:

  1. Index Methodology – How the underlying assets are selected.
  2. Performance – Historical returns and volatility.
  3. Costs – Management fees and expense ratios.
  4. Fund Size and Age – Larger, more established funds may offer stability.
  5. Domicile – Regulatory and tax implications based on the fund’s location.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Are crypto ETFs available in Europe?

Due to UCITS regulations, Europe primarily offers crypto ETNs rather than ETFs. These provide direct exposure but aren’t UCITS-compliant.

2. What’s the difference between a crypto ETF and an ETN?

  • ETFs typically hold a basket of assets (e.g., blockchain stocks).
  • ETNs are debt instruments backed by the issuer, often holding physical crypto.

3. Can I earn staking rewards with crypto ETNs?

Yes, if the ETN holds proof-of-stake coins like Ether. Rewards may reduce fees or increase your holdings.

4. How do Blockchain ETFs work?

They invest in companies involved in blockchain tech, offering indirect crypto exposure without owning coins.
